Afrisquare
276 Videos 1 Follower 1 Approval 30 K ViewsAfrisquare: African Traditional Heritage, ultimate collection of Afro centric videos, showcasing dances, masquerades and other depictions of the African culture and traditions.
All Videos
Latest Video
Created 1 year ago